Global polyimide foam market was valued at USD 247 million in 2024. The market is projected to grow from USD 258 million in 2025 to USD 337 million by 2032, exhibiting a CAGR of 4.7 % during the forecast period.

Polyimide foam is a high‑performance material originally developed by Inspec Foams Inc. for NASA under the brand name Solimide. This advanced foam serves as an effective insulator for extreme temperature applications (including rocket fuel storage) and provides superior acoustic dampening properties. Key characteristics include lightweight composition, exceptional fire resistance, and the ability to be molded into complex shapes, making it ideal for aerospace, marine, and industrial applications.

The market growth is driven by increasing demand from the aerospace sector, where stringent fire safety regulations necessitate advanced insulation materials. While North America dominates with 81 % market share (primarily due to robust aerospace and defense spending), Europe follows with 9 % penetration. Recent developments include material innovations by leading players such as Boyd Corporation and DuPont to enhance thermal stability. However, high production costs remain a challenge for broader commercial adoption across industries.
